Pros
Good benefits Casual Simple (but still hard) work Okay pay
Cons
People in management are more greedy than logical, have no control over their emotions, and treat people inhumanely (causing workers to quit/ not come into work, which causes staff shortage). Sexism and sexual harassment is rampant (among upper management and coworkers) and ignored/ laughed at when brought up. Will lie to new hires to manipulate them into working faster even when dangerous (and will blame them/ fire them if injured). Horrible working environment that makes the actual work (which is not that bad once you get used to it) more difficult than it has to be. You just basically need to watch out for yourself, stick with your fellow coworkers, and use your union reps when needed. And don't trust any supervisors - some are kind and chill, but are pressured/bullied by upper management to abuse their workers.
